The new Aqualog is the only instrument to simultaneously measure both absorbance spectra and fluorescence Excitation-Emission Matrices. EEMs are acquired up to 100 times faster than with other instruments. Dedicated software automates traceable Quinine Sulfate Unit calibration and correction of inner-filter effects and Rayleigh and ...

The HORIBA Fluorolog-QM series of modular research grade spectrofluorometers is the fourth generation of the world famous HORIBA Fluorolog, with the first Fluorolog introduced by Spex Industries in 1975. The Fluorolog-QM represents the culmination of decades of HORIBA’s industry-leading experience in development and ...

Did You know?

Fluorescence spectroscopy is a technique that analyses the emitted fluorescence from a sample that has been excited by a beam of light (usually UV). The emitted light – the fluorescence – contains spectral information on the molecular vibrations of the studied sample. Generally, two types of instruments are currently available on market – filter fluorometers and spectrofluorometer. Filter Fluorometers contain an optical filtration system to filter out the excitation beam to allow high-sensitivity detection of the fluorescent light. In contrast, spectrofluorometers usually contain gratings based monochromator systems to isolate the incident excitation beam. Advances in the sensitivity of detection have recently allowed adapting this technique at microscopic levels for the study of biochemical and biophysical properties of cells by combining microscopy and fluorescence spectroscopy into a new technique called microfluorimetry.
